Own a 2001 T5 - has run great for 4+ years with 90K on car. Start of March my automatic trans started to slip - very pronounced between 55 -70 miles per hour yet engine and tach don't jump. Received latest software updates and flush ATF - no help. Dealership in nice way saying I have to live with it and tuff - this is hard to believe.

May be unrelated, but at the same time a buzz type of vibration occuring through the pedals.

What should I do? Worried that some day soon trans will drop while on the road.

There really isn't all that much you can do besides replace the trans.

If you just had the Software update done within the past couple of day drive it some and let the Computer re adapt to your driving.

The Dealer is supposed to run an adaption that will take them about 40 minutes to do.
